GNU/Linux >> Znalost Linux >  >> Linux

Jak vypsat závislosti statické knihovny c/c++?

@Některý programátor má pravdu, ale co můžete udělat, je vytvořit jednoduchý program pomocí této knihovny staticky a poté zkontrolovat pomocí ldd -v jaké jsou závislosti.


Statická knihovna mít žádný takový seznam závislostí.

Statická knihovna není nic jiného než archiv objektových souborů. A protože objektové soubory nevědí, na kterých knihovnách závisí, ani statická knihovna to nedokáže.


Linux
  1. Jak určit kódování znaků, které terminál používá v programu C/c++?

  2. C++:jakou knihovnu regulárních výrazů bych měl použít?

  3. Co je soubor .so.2?

  1. Jak používat příkaz „repoquery“ k výpisu závislostí balíčků

  2. Jak programově způsobit výpis jádra v C/C++

  3. Co je soubor .so?

  1. Jak zobrazím seznam funkcí, které exportuje sdílená knihovna Linuxu?

  2. Jak získat uživatelské jméno v C/C++ v Linuxu?

  3. Jak zahrnout statickou knihovnu do makefile